In early September, at the Public Administration Service Center (PVHCC) of Phu Xuan ward, the working atmosphere was orderly and neat. Records were entered and processed on the electronic system, and people were enthusiastically guided by staff to operate online right on their phones.
“Previously, to get my child’s birth certificate, I had to go back and forth several times; now I just need to submit the application and fee online, and receive the results a few days later, much faster,” said Ms. Nguyen Thi Thanh, a resident of residential group 5.
According to the Ward People's Committee, more than 80% of the current records are processed online, of which over 95% are on time and on schedule. The digital signature system, operating software, and online public service portal are operated synchronously; 100% of the staff are proficient in using electronic tools.
“We determine that administrative reform must be associated with digital transformation, transparency, and saving time for people,” affirmed Mr. Nguyen Viet Bang, Chairman of Phu Xuan Ward People's Committee.
At the Public Service Center, people can look up the progress of their application and pay fees simply by scanning a QR code. These seemingly small solutions help eliminate the prejudice of cumbersome administrative procedures, replacing them with a quick and friendly experience.
Phu Xuan has established a community digital technology team and a rapid response team. Young staff directly “hold hands and show how”, support people to install applications and submit online applications.
Mr. Le Van Dung (61 years old, residential group 8) said that at first he was hesitant to do the procedure through the online system because he was afraid of the complexity. “But the staff gave me enthusiastic instructions, now I am used to it, I can still submit my application while sitting at home; very convenient,” said Mr. Dung.
Phu Xuan Ward has promoted propaganda, linking the movement "cadres supporting people" with the use of online public services, gradually forming electronic administrative habits, especially among young people and the elderly.
Technology infrastructure is focused on investment: high-speed CPnet network, modern computer system, security surveillance cameras at many "hot spots". The ward coordinates with departments, branches and international organizations (Bretagne Association) to exchange and learn experiences in innovation and digital transformation. The ward Party Committee is using document management software, online management and party member database program version 3.0, managing nearly 3,700 party members. The ward People's Committee operates many systems at the same time: From household registration management, work schedule, official email to Hue city reporting system (LRIS). Thanks to that, records are processed quickly, on time, minimizing errors, and significantly reducing the amount of manual paperwork.
However, the digitization of archived records is difficult due to the large amount of documents from the 6 merged old wards. “Up to now, basically public services at levels 3 and 4 have been put on the system, we are continuing to review and restructure the procedures. The long-term goal is to be “paperless” in handling administrative procedures,” said Mr. Bang.
Not only stopping at administrative procedures, Phu Xuan also applies digital transformation to many management areas. Work management software is synchronized, helping ward leaders easily monitor, direct and store data safely.
In the coming time, Phu Xuan will promote the digitization of cadastral data, integrating population, land, construction data... into the general management system. At that time, all administrative procedures can be performed 100% online.
